  5. STEVEN DAVIS will become Steven Gerrard’s next Rangers signing within 24 hours. Rangers are due to sign Steven Davis within the next 24 hours Davis has accepted a major pay-cut to complete the move back to Ibrox, six-and-a-half-years after leaving for Southampton. The Northern Ireland international has barely had a look-in so far this term at St Mary’s and will be allowed to join Gerrard’s side on a free transfer. Davis will add vital experience to the middle of midfield as Rangers look to pip rivals Celtic to the Scottish Premiership title. He’s agreed a £12,000-a-week, 18-month contract with the Gers. Davis could make his debut when the Glasgow giants return to action after the winter break on January 18, when minnows Cowdenbeath are the opponents in a Scottish Cup fourth-round tie.
